Abstract

The invention relates to a headphone device and a manufacturing method thereof. The headphone device comprises a wearing part and two headphone elements, wherein materials of the wearing part comprise bamboo, and the headphone elements are respectively pivotally connected at two end parts of the wearing part. A clamping unit is utilized for fixing a bamboo piece for bending the bamboo piece to be in the shape of a circular arc. Then, the carbonization process is used for processing the bamboo piece for molding the bamboo piece, and then the two headphone components are respectively pivotally arranged at two end parts of the bamboo piece.

Embodiment
Shown in Fig. 2 and Fig. 3 A, wherein Fig. 2 is the process step figure of the Headphone device manufacture method of preferred embodiment of the present invention, and Fig. 3 A is the manufacture process schematic diagram of the Headphone device of present embodiment.The manufacture method of the Headphone device of present embodiment comprises step S01 to step S04.Please earlier with reference to Fig. 3 A, with description of step S01 to step S04.Step S01 is for providing a grip unit 3.Step S02 makes its bending be a circular arc for utilizing tool 3 to fix a bamboo chip B.Step S03 is that carbonization technique processing bamboo chip B makes the bamboo chip moulding.
In step S01 and step S02, grip unit 3 can comprise a supporting body 31, one first holder 32 and one second holder 33.Wherein, the spacing of first holder 32 and second holder 33 is less than the length of bamboo chip B.Therefore, utilize bamboo wood to have flexual characteristic, when first holder 32 and second holder 33 respectively during the both ends of clamping bamboo chip B, the middle part of bamboo chip B is then stressed and crooked.
In addition, in present embodiment, grip unit 3 can also comprise one the 3rd holder 34, and so it is non-limiting.The 3rd holder 34 and first holder 32 and second holder 33 are delta arrangement (for example be isosceles triangle, but not as limit), and the 3rd holder 34 is in order to the middle part of clamping bamboo chip B, with so that bamboo chip B can positively be bent into default circular arc.Wherein, the shape of bamboo chip B for example can be the circular arc of the person's of being used capitiform or slightly is ㄇ word shape and has the circular arc of angle slightly, or other different design shape, and also not having can not.
Moreover, in present embodiment, with three holders 32,33,34 and with the screw lock mode fixedly bamboo chip B explain, so it is non-limiting.Therefore, utilize first holder 32, second holder 33 and the elasticity of the 3rd holder 34 screw locks and the position of setting, can adjust crooked radian and the curved shape of bamboo chip B.
Then, can carry out carbonization technique to bamboo chip B and handle, and make bamboo chip B moulding, wear part to form one.The temperature that carbonization technique is handled is between 140 ℃ to 160 ℃, and steam pressure is between 3kg/cm 2To 5kg/cm 2Between, the processing time is then between 30 minutes to 60 minutes.Therefore, after high temperature, HIGH PRESSURE TREATMENT, bamboo chip B can change the color and luster of nearly carbon black into what is more by the light brown dark brown that changes into, and color can be deep or light not, so that the level of bamboo chip B and the aesthetic feeling of natural texture are presented.
In addition, after carbonization technique was handled, bamboo chip B elastic strength reduced, but still possesses certain toughness, therefore can keep and wear the required shape of part, and utilize the toughness of bamboo wood own to be applicable to different users's head circumference size.
Shown in Fig. 2, Fig. 3 A and Fig. 3 B, wherein Fig. 3 B is for the schematic diagram of the Headphone device 2 of preferred embodiment of the present invention, with description of step S04.Step S04 is for being hubbed at two earphone element 21 respectively the both ends of bamboo chip B.
In the present embodiment, be that bamboo wood is an example, so after bamboo chip B moulding was finished, what promptly can be used as Headphone device 2 wore part 22 with all material of wearing part 22.Certainly, wear part 22 also can have only the part material be bamboo wood.Then, these earphone element 21 can be hubbed at the both ends of bamboo chip B, in order to do making the ear location that earphone element 21 can the person of being used, and rotate a little with respect to wearing part 22, to promote the comfortableness of product.Wherein, these earphone element 21 also can be connected with a source of sound connecting line 23, utilize source of sound connecting line 23 and are connected with the music player (not shown), are sent to these earphone element 21 with the signal with music player output.
Utilization has the material of bamboo wood as wearing part 22 except that the advantage with environmental protection, and the elasticity of bamboo wood itself can make and be linked to these earphone element 21 of wearing part 22 (for example circular arc is worn part 22) two ends, more closely engage with user's two ears, utilize the toughness of bamboo wood itself then to make Headphone device 2 be difficult for producing fracture or distortion, even and if bamboo wood does not also hinder representing in color and luster of bamboo wood own and lines because of long-term the use has wearing and tearing slightly.
In addition, as Fig. 3 B and shown in Figure 4, wherein Fig. 4 be present embodiment Headphone device manufacture method another change the process step figure of aspect.The manufacture method of the Headphone device of present embodiment also can comprise step S11 and step S12.Step S11 is for handling bamboo chip by the way of boiling; Step S12 is for being coated with a waterproof material in the bamboo chip surface.
To be fixed in before the step of grip unit as the bamboo chip of wearing part 22, can utilize the poach mode earlier, so that the sugar of supracutaneous greasy dirt of bamboo wood and bamboo meat is removed, to reach insect protected, mildew-resistant and effects such as preservation easily.Then, the bamboo skin pruned and planish the bamboo chip of Cheng Tongkuan and stack pile, again bamboo chip is fixed on the tool.
In addition; carbonization technique is handled the back and can be utilized marine glue or wax covering protection bamboo chip surface to reach good waterproof effect as the bamboo chip of wearing part 22; but the material of this waterproof material is not as limit, and this can be avoided wearing part 22 and cause the mouldy damage of bamboo wood moisture and deteriorate because of aqueous vapor.With wax is example, and bamboo face gloss, sense of touch after waxing do not have notable difference, and the use of part 22 is worn in unlikely influence, again can be with water-proof function.In addition, the step of coating waterproof material can be after these earphone element be hubbed at bamboo chip, or these earphone element are hubbed at before the bamboo chip.In the present embodiment, before these earphone element are hubbed at bamboo chip, be example with the step that is coated with waterproof material.
